If anyone has been having problems with loss of signal* / picture breakup during this hot spell, try hosing down the lnb (the bit on the end of the arm on the dish). This will cool it down.
Sounds silly, but the insanely hot temperatures could be pushing a failing lnb off tune (theres a little electronic oscillator in there and if it drifts off frequency it can cause problems. DONT dunk the lnb into a bowl of water- that would be bad -- you want to cool it not drown it ! :'(Should this cure a problem you need to be thinking about replacing the lnb - especially if its been up a few years.... Remember the earliest Sky Digital dishes have been up nearly 8 years now
